Output 5b68314aaf2938cc0b24345cabd86d5c47c29184c3e971767fd0b438639f94f7:24

value
677740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df6f46fd94fe66533bb1adbffd398fe05540acee OP_EQUAL
address
3N4Rv1EH15Ng563gadhdC6NukTcwZHHJLi
transaction
5b68314aaf2938cc0b24345cabd86d5c47c29184c3e971767fd0b438639f94f7
spent
true